What is Tui Na Massage?
Ma Kuang's Tui Na in Singapore combines massage, trigger-point, and other manual techniques to stimulate acupoints, meridians, muscles and/or nerves, in order to unblock the flow of Qi (vital energy) in the body.
What Conditions Can Tui Na Massage Treat?
Tui Na massage can treat shoulder and back pain, neck pain, acute torticollis, frozen shoulder, low back and leg pain, intervertebral disc disease, sciatica, knee pain, heel pain, acute sprain/strain, joint misalignment, post-stroke symptoms, vertigo, migraine.
What Are The Therapeutic Effects Of Tui Na Massage?
Tui Na massage unblocks the meridians, facilitates joint lubrication, promotes the flow of Qi, increases blood circulation, normalises visceral functions, and boosts immunity.
How Is Tui Na Massage Therapy Carried Out?
Prior to the TCM body massage session, the physician or therapist will obtain a good understanding of the patient’s condition. The patient will be asked to expose affected area as needed during manual treatment. In other instances, the TCM massage therapy can be delivered over clothing. The Tui Na massage session usually takes 20-60 minutes, depending on the individual’s condition. Follow-ups may be needed. What Are The Responses After Tui Na Massage in Singapore?
Please drink a glass of warm water after Tui Na massage, and avoid cold shower for an hour following completion of therapy. During the first few days after the TCM massage treatment, soreness, mild skin redness and swelling are normal. However, if the signs and symptoms persist, or undesirable reactions such as nausea and lightheadedness develop, please consult your physician or therapist immediately.
Who Should Be Cautious About Receiving Tui Na Massage?
People with acute abdominal compartment syndrome, bleeding disorders, skin wound, ulceration or burns, severe heart disease, critical illness, and pregnant women, please consult your physician or therapist before receiving our Tui Na massage in Singapore.
